Who created the first running shoe with a carbon sole?
Nike is the company that introduced the first running shoe with a carbon fiber sole with the launch of the Nike Zoom Vaporfly 4%. It was developed in 2017 and was specifically aimed at improving the performance of elite marathon runners. Nike collaborated with top engineers, researchers and athletes to create a shoe that gave runners a competitive edge in long-distance races. The name «4%» comes from the claim that these shoes can improve runners’ efficiency by approximately 4%, a percentage that can be decisive in marathon races.

The inclusion of a carbon fiber plate in running shoes provides several advantages, especially for long-distance runners. Here are the key benefits:
1. Improved Energy Return
The carbon plate acts like a spring, providing a «kickback» effect that helps propel the runner forward. This means that less energy is wasted with each step, and more of the energy is returned to the runner. This can result in improved efficiency and less fatigue, particularly during long races.
2. Enhanced Stability and Propulsion
The carbon plate adds rigidity to the midsole, giving the shoe a more stable feel during the running gait. This rigidity helps with better push-off and smoother transitions from heel to toe, promoting faster running speeds.
3. Reduced Muscle Fatigue
By increasing energy return and making the shoe more responsive, runners may experience less muscle fatigue over time, as the shoe helps do some of the work that would otherwise be absorbed by the muscles, especially over long distances.
4. Improved Running Economy
The carbon plate helps optimize running mechanics, which can improve running economy. Running economy refers to the amount of energy required to maintain a given pace. With the added efficiency, runners can maintain faster speeds for longer periods with less effort.
5. Increased Speed
Due to the combined effect of improved energy return and propulsion, runners are often able to run faster with less perceived effort. Many elite marathoners have recorded personal bests while wearing shoes with carbon plates.
6. Lightweight Design
Despite the added technology of the carbon plate, many of these shoes remain relatively lightweight. The design typically uses lightweight foam (like Nike’s ZoomX) in combination with the carbon plate to create a shoe that doesn’t feel heavy, allowing for faster movement.

Popular Models of Carbon Fiber Sole Running Shoes
Since the introduction of the Nike Vaporfly 4%, other major brands have followed suit, releasing their own versions of carbon fiber running shoes:
- Nike Alphafly Next%: An evolution of the Vaporfly with dual Air Zoom pods and improved energy return.
- Adidas Adizero Adios Pro: Featuring EnergyRods for optimized propulsion.
- Saucony Endorphin Pro: Combining SpeedRoll technology with a carbon plate for a smooth and fast ride.
- Hoka One One Carbon X: Known for its stability and comfort in addition to performance gains.
